RGB, HSL and CMYK Values
RGB
116, 129, 120
Red: 116 / Green: 129 / Blue: 120
HSL
138°, 5%, 48%
Hue: 138° / Saturation: 5% / Lightness: 48%
CMYK
10%, 0%, 7%, 49%
Cyan: 10% / Magenta: 0% / Yellow: 7% / Key: 49%
